Police continue Parkview deaths probe

A couple arrested in connection with five deaths at a residential care home in Butleigh, near Glastonbury were released on police bail pending further enquiries yesterday afternoon.

A couple arrested in connection with five deaths at a Somerset care home near Glastonbury, have been released on bail as police continue their enquiries.

The 45-year-old woman and 48-year-old man were arrested on Monday on suspicion of the murder of four women and one man, theft and unlawful possession of controlled and prescribed controlled drugs and perverting the course of justice. The investigation centres on the former Parkfields Residential Care Home in Butleigh.

Avon and Somerset Police released the woman, care home manager Rachel Baker, on Wednesday evening. Her husband, chef Leigh Baker, was released yesterday.
